(This note is not part of the Regulations.)
These Regulations further amend the Travelling Expenses and Remission of Charges Regulations (Northern Ireland) 1989 (“the principal Regulations”) which provide for remission and repayment of certain charges which would otherwise be payable under the Health and Personal Social Services (Northern Ireland) Order 1972 and for the payment by the Department of travelling expenses incurred in attending a hospital.
In particular
regulation 4 of the principal Regulations is amended by providing for the remission of dental charges to be determined by reference to the patient’s circumstances either at the time the arrangements for treatment are made or at the time the charge for treatment is made and by providing for remission to apply in respect of the whole course of treatment concerned.
the Schedule to the principal Regulations is amended to modify the application of the Income Support Regulations in relation to the treatment of students and in relation to the calculation of personal allowances and family premiums. Under the principal Regulations, the resources and requirements of claimants are calculated by reference to the Income Support (General) Regulations (Northern Ireland) 1987, as modified.
